DIY-SDFS:オンサイト利用を想定したIoTデータ向け複数NAS統合型ファイルシステム

Bibliographic Information

Other Title
  • DIY-SDFS: A NAS Interated File System for On-site IoT Data Storage

Search this article

Description

Arduino,Raspberry Piなどのコンピューティングデバイス,BLE,LPWAなどの通信技術の登場によってIoTが爆発的に広まってきている.IoTデータを長時間取得する際,日々増加し続ける大量のセンサデータを保存するためのストレージが問題となる.本稿では,IoTが駆動する現場で利用するための複数Network Attached Storage(NAS)統合型ファイルシステム「Do It Yourself-Sensor Data File System(DIY-SDFS)」を提案する.DIY-SDFSはユーザ空間にファイルシステムを実装するためのインターフェイスであるFUSE(Filesystem in USErspace)を使用して開発した.DIY-SDFSは複数のNASが1つのファイルシステムとして扱えるだけでなく,容易に新しいNASを追加できるなどの特徴を兼ね備えている.DIY-SDFSをaufsやunionfs-fuseなどの既存のファイルシステムと比較したところ,同等の読み込み・書き込みスループットを達成することを確認した.

In the case of IoT data acquisition, long-term storage of large amounts of sensor data is a significant challenge. When a cloud service is used, fixed costs such as a communication line for uploading and a monthly fee are unavoidable. In addition, the use of large-capacity storage servers incurs high initial installation costs. In this paper, we propose a Network Attached Storage (NAS) integrated file system called the “Do It Yourself-Sensor Data File System (DIY-SDFS)”, which has advantages of being on-site, low-cost, and highly scalable. We developed the DIY-SDFS using FUSE (Filesystem in USErspace), which is an interface for implementing file systems in user-space. DIY-SDFS not only allows multiple NAS to be treated as a single file system but also has functions that facilitate the ease of the addition of storage. In this paper, we compared DIY-SDFS with existing integrated storage modalities such as aufs and unionfs-fuse. The results indicate that DIY-SDFS achieves an equivalent throughput compared with existing file systems in terms of read/write performance.

Journal

Related Projects

See more

Details 詳細情報について

Report a problem

Back to top